2010-01-10 14 views
0

Je suis à la recherche d'un système de marque, le long des lignes de CMake ou Bakefile, qui prend en charge la génération des fichiers de projet Visual Studio et makefile (ciblant Linux) double ciblage x86 et x64 (dans le même fichier projet/make).système de marque multi-plateforme supportant 32/64 cibles de bits sur Windows et Linux

Je l'ai regardé CMake et Bakefile et ils ont tous deux semblent avoir des limites à cet égard; ils semblent tous les deux ne pas supporter plusieurs cibles (Bakefile ne semble même pas supporter 64bit vcproj).

Y a-t-il d'autres outils, open source ou payé, qui peut convenir?

Répondre

1

Il y a un (simple) patch for Bakefile qui lui permet - vous pourriez être en mesure d'aider à tester.

+0

Très bien, cela résout le problème – hplbsh

0

CMake peut générer du code plusieurs architectures cibles (32 et 64 bits, par exemple) sur différentes plates-formes (gagner et Linux, par exemple). Je peux également utiliser qmake (une partie de Qt) pour cela.

0

Bien qu'il soit un outil de niveau supérieur et que vous savez probablement déjà à ce sujet, je propose SCons.